In the television series Terminator: The Sarah Connor Chronicles, "Heavy Metal" is a colloquial term or slang used by human characters, most notably Sarah and John Connor, to refer to Terminators. This designation highlights the machines' metallic endoskeletons and their formidable, unyielding nature.
The term serves as an informal, often derogatory, label for the relentless robotic assassins sent from the future to eliminate key figures or alter the timeline. It emphasizes their inorganic construction and their often destructive capabilities, distinguishing them from human beings. The use of "Heavy Metal" by the protagonists helps to create a sense of shared jargon and internal culture among those fighting against Skynet, providing a shorthand for their seemingly indestructible adversaries.
